Output 5764d1729b3c6f5c82e7742f03f08252bcae4be7f8c975691979e22a11fb66d7:1

value
25253072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aeff4fa928b77cd1226c65ba0ccef7303afba14 OP_EQUALVERIFY OP_CHECKSIG
address
16NdedP16UzY5peuTRMRnC5MLFMGDYDKt1
transaction
5764d1729b3c6f5c82e7742f03f08252bcae4be7f8c975691979e22a11fb66d7
confirmations
459428
spent
true